This is a synthesis reaction in which sodium and chlorine combine to form sodium chloride. It can also be called a combination reaction.

The equilibrium constant, K_eq, for the reaction 2HCl(g) ⇌ H2(g) + Cl2(g) is equal to the concentration of H2 and Cl2 divided by the concentration of HCl squared, as products are in the numerator and reactants in the denominator.
